P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F MICHIGAN, Plaintiff-Appellee, v. RAYMOND CURTIS CARP, Defendant-Appellant.


Order

146478(142) Robert P. Young, Jr., Chief Justice Michael F. Cavanagh Stephen J. Markman Mary Beth Kelly Brian K. Zahra Bridget M. McCormack David F. Viviano, Justices COA: 307758
St. Clair CC: 06-001700-FC

On order of the Chief Justice, the motion of defendant-appellant for leave to file supplemental authority is GRANTED. The supplemental authority submitted on October 15, 2014, is accepted for filing.
